The Best Robot Vacuums

No matter if you have a 3,000-square-foot home with three shaggy dogs or an elegant apartment A robot vacuum is an excellent option for keeping your floors spotless. The best models have self-emptying bases, dock and recharge automatically and include features such as cliff sensors.

If you have carpet, search for a model with high suction power measured in Pascal (Pa). No-go zones and virtual barriers permit you to define areas the robot shouldn't enter.

Smart Mapping

Many robot vacuums don't come with mapping capabilities. This can be a problem if you are trying to get your home clean. These vacuums that are budget-friendly can be stuck on a wide range of obstacles, including cords, furniture legs, and pet toys that have appeared from the sofa cushions.

This is why the top robot vacuum cleaner price vacuums that have obstacle avoidance employ multiple sensors and cameras to create a detailed map of the room as they move through your home. They can move more efficiently through your home, cleaning in a logical order and not having to waste time on areas they have already cleaned. This also helps them avoid getting stuck on objects that have been moved during a cleaning session, or needing to spend more time "robot-proofing" your home by putting cords out of their way.

Robot vacuums employ different navigation techniques that range from the simplest up to the most sophisticated. Some budget models use infrared sensors, while others utilize optical sensors that measure the amount of time it takes for a reflected signal to reach the robot's backside. This allows the good robot vacuum to determine its position within the room. Certain high-end robots, such as the Eufy S1 Pro, remote control vacuum Cleaner have a feature known as SLAM navigation that uses a combination of sensors to build a map when it moves around the room.

This is the most modern approach, since not only does it allow the robots to navigate more efficiently, but it also offers an interface that is useful for the user. These systems display a 3D model with which you can interact with, and can also establish virtual boundaries or zones that are restricted to the robot. This type of mapping can be used even in darkness as long as there is an illumination source nearby (like a table lamp) that is bright enough for the robot to see surroundings.

self cleaning vacuum-Emptying Dustbins

Robot vacuums are attractive because they can transfer debris from their onboard dustbins to their docking base with no user intervention. This means that you don't have to constantly bend down to empty the bin which reduces the frequency of maintenance tasks. This is particularly important if your home is large and you wish to reduce the time that your hands are used to handle dust and dirt.

It can take as long as seven hours for a robot to fully charged and ready to go again. This isn't ideal for large families or families with busy schedules. Many manufacturers allow pausing cleaning and continuing where the robot left off after its battery has been charged. This feature is available on most robots. It is great for parents with children or who frequently leave their home to go to work.

When you are choosing a self-emptying machine, consider whether it uses a bag or an unbagged system to collect debris. A bagged model will ensure that dust doesn't release in the air after it's emptied, but you will need to buy and replace the bags frequently. If you prefer a bag-less model, look for models with a smart sensor to check the dustbin onboard and alert you when it's time to empty it.

In addition to self-emptying bins, the best robotic cleaners also come with cliff sensors and docking sensors that prevent them from falling over or getting stuck in the middle of obstacles. They also have advanced artificial intelligence to enhance performance and avoid different types of debris.

Most robot vacuums need regular maintenance and attention to ensure they are operating properly. This includes regular cleaning of the brushroll, side brushes and wheels to get rid of pet hair and other debris that could cause obstructions and decrease suction power. It is also important to check the robot's battery level regularly to ensure that it is always charged to its maximum capacity. A low or flat battery can slow down the robot and make it work less efficiently, making it vital to monitor its charge regularly.

Robotic vacuum cleaners operate remotely and can be controlled via apps, voice commands, or traditional remotes. They also come with automatic floor cleaning machine self-charging functions as well as scheduling features, which make it easy to maintain the cleanliness of your home without manual intervention. This functionality is a great benefit for those with limited mobility and strength, as it eliminates the necessity to lift heavy furniture or struggle to reach awkward spaces.

The top robotic vacuums are designed to deal with a variety flooring surfaces and obstacles, adjusting their operation to meet. They often include sensors that can detect different areas of the room and adjust accordingly. This feature lets a robot automatically switch between cleaning methods when switching from tile, carpet, hardwood or other types of flooring.

These machines with intelligence can be beneficial to families with a busy lifestyle and guests who are frequently present. Robot vacuums can be programmed to clean your home while you're away. And they can also return to their docking station if the power runs out. This can help you save money and time by avoiding the stress of a dirty home.

If you select one that is smart-compatible it can connect to your Wi-Fi network, and also communicate with your smartphone. This lets you manage the device via an app, schedule cleaning sessions, and check on your battery status and mapping history. If your robovac comes with cameras it can also be used with the app to review photos of your space. This is useful for detecting objects the robot may have missed during its previous cleaning trip.

The majority of the top robots come with this smart integration. Some robots are compatible with Google Assistant. This means that you can use them simply by giving a command through the smart speaker. Some devices may experience issues communicating with Google Assistant due to signal strength or proximity. This issue can be resolved by ensuring that the device is up-to date and removing any barriers between your router and it, or even using a Wi-Fi extension.
